Enhancing Ethereum RPC Latency for Improved Network Performance

Visualizing Ethereum RPC Latency Improvement: Interconnected Node Points on a Globe

Introduction: Addressing Ethereum RPC Latency Challenges

In the realm of blockchain technology, Ethereum stands as a pioneering platform, revolutionizing how we perceive and engage with decentralized applications. However, like any intricate system, Ethereum faces its share of challenges, one of which is RPC latency. This article delves into the matter of Ethereum RPC latency, its implications, and strategies to optimize it for a seamless network experience.

Understanding Ethereum RPC and Its Significance

Before we explore the intricacies of RPC latency, let’s grasp the essence of Ethereum’s Remote Procedure Call (RPC) protocol. RPC serves as a bridge that allows external entities to interact with the Ethereum blockchain. It facilitates the exchange of information between the blockchain and applications, playing a pivotal role in the ecosystem’s functionality.

The Impacts of Latency on Network Performance

RPC latency, characterized by delays in communication between nodes and applications, can have far-reaching consequences. Slow RPC responses hinder the execution of smart contracts, delay transaction confirmations, and impede real-time interactions, thereby diminishing the overall user experience.

Strategies to Optimize Ethereum RPC Latency

To mitigate the adverse effects of RPC latency, several strategies can be employed:

1. Node Infrastructure Enhancement

Upgrading and optimizing the infrastructure of Ethereum nodes can significantly enhance RPC response times. Utilizing powerful hardware, employing efficient load balancing techniques, and implementing caching mechanisms can all contribute to smoother RPC interactions.

2. Efficient Data Indexing

Efficient data indexing is paramount to reduce the time required for fetching information from the Ethereum blockchain. By employing advanced indexing mechanisms and optimizing database queries, developers can expedite data retrieval and consequently minimize RPC latency.

3. Compression Techniques

Implementing data compression techniques during RPC communication can lead to faster transmission of data between nodes and applications. Compressed data requires less time to travel across the network, ultimately reducing latency.

4. Load Distribution Mechanisms

Distributing incoming RPC requests across multiple nodes through load distribution mechanisms can prevent any single node from becoming a bottleneck. This approach ensures balanced processing and maintains consistent RPC response times.

Transitioning Towards Optimal Ethereum Network Experience

In conclusion, the issue of Ethereum RPC latency is a hurdle that demands proactive measures to sustain the network’s efficiency. By comprehending the significance of RPC, acknowledging the impacts of latency, and adopting strategic optimization techniques, the Ethereum community can collectively usher in a new era of network performance.

Remember, a seamless Ethereum experience relies on the collaboration between cutting-edge technology and innovative solutions, working hand in hand to create a dynamic ecosystem where latency is a thing of the past. As the blockchain landscape continues to evolve, optimizing RPC latency remains a pivotal step towards realizing the full potential of Ethereum’s capabilities.

Follow us on:

John Doe
John Doe@username
Read More
Lorem ipsum dolor sit amet, consectetur adipiscing elit. Ut elit tellus, luctus nec ullamcorper mattis, pulvinar dapibus leo.
John Doe
John Doe@username
Read More
Lorem ipsum dolor sit amet, consectetur adipiscing elit. Ut elit tellus, luctus nec ullamcorper mattis, pulvinar dapibus leo.
John Doe
John Doe@username
Read More
Lorem ipsum dolor sit amet, consectetur adipiscing elit. Ut elit tellus, luctus nec ullamcorper mattis, pulvinar dapibus leo.
Previous
Next

Leave a Reply

Your email address will not be published. Required fields are marked *